What is the Post-operative Orders for Total Joint Pathway?

The Post-operative Orders for Total Joint Pathway is a crucial medical form designed to guide the post-operative care for patients undergoing total joint surgeries, specifically total hip arthroplasty (THA), total knee arthroplasty (TKA), and shoulder surgery. This form plays a significant role in ensuring structured post-operative care instructions are documented appropriately for each patient. It outlines critical guidelines for medical documentation and care that healthcare providers follow after surgical procedures.

Key Features of the Post-operative Orders for Total Joint Pathway

This form includes several key components that are essential for effective patient monitoring and care. The major sections of the form are as follows:
  • Allergies - Identifying any patient allergies is vital for safe medication administration.
  • Activities - Outlining allowed activities post-surgery supports patient recovery.
  • CPM settings - Provides specific instructions for continuous passive motion therapy.
Each section must be filled out meticulously to ensure comprehensive post-operative guidance, with particular attention to the instructions provided for healthcare providers on completing the form accurately.

Who Needs to Fill Out the Post-operative Orders for Total Joint Pathway?

Several healthcare roles are involved in the completion of the Post-operative Orders for Total Joint Pathway form. Surgeons are primarily responsible for authorizing orders, while nurses play a significant role in documenting patient care and executing the directives outlined in the form. According to institutional policies, only medical doctors (MDs) are authorized to sign this form, highlighting the importance of collaboration among healthcare providers in patient care management.
